4-[(2-acetylphenyl)diazenyl]-N-[4-[2,4-bis(2-methylbutan-2-yl)phenoxy]butyl]-1-hydroxynaphthalene-2-carboxamide

Also Known As: 1-hydroxy-naphthalene-2-carboxylicacid hydrazide, 2-Naphthalenecarboxamide, 4-[(2-acetylphenyl)azo]-N-[4-[2,4-bis(1,1-dimethylpropyl)phenoxy]butyl]-1-hydroxy-, 2-Naphthalenecarboxamide, 4-((2-acetylphenyl)azo)-N-(4-(2,4-bis(1,1-dimethylpropyl)phenoxy)butyl)-1-hydroxy-, 2-Naphthalenecarboxamide, 4-(2-(2-acetylphenyl)diazenyl)-N-(4-(2,4-bis(1,1-dimethylpropyl)phenoxy)butyl)-1-hydroxy-, (4Z)-4-[(2-acetylphenyl)hydrazinylidene]-N-[4-[2,4-bis(2-methylbutan-2-yl)phenoxy]butyl]-1-oxonaphthalene-2-carboxamide

CAS: 32180-77-1
Molecular Formula C39H47N3O4
Molecular Weight 621.36 g/mol
LogP 10.9
Topological Polar Surface Area 100.0 Ų
Hydrogen Bond Donors 2
Hydrogen Bond Acceptors 6
Rotatable Bonds 14
Exact Mass 621.3566
Heavy Atoms 46
Complexity 1010.0

Chemical Identifiers

CAS Number 32180-77-1
SMILES CCC(C)(C)C1=CC(=C(C=C1)OCCCCNC(=O)C2=C(C3=CC=CC=C3C(=C2)N=NC4=CC=CC=C4C(=O)C)O)C(C)(C)CC
InChIKey KONWYIUWNVFTHQ-UHFFFAOYSA-N

Patent-Derived Application Labels

Derived from 2 IPC patent classification(s) across the SureChEMBL global patent database.

Coatings & Adhesives (1 patents) Photographic Chemicals (37 patents)
